Overview

Industry 4.0 or Manufacturing 4.0 powers connected enterprises via automation, cyber-physical systems, sensors, IoT, the cloud, and advanced analytics. It starts from product design and ends with order fulfillment and servicing.

Most, if not all, value chain instances such as products, assets, fleet, infrastructure, markets, and people are connected. This is accomplished by joining relevant operational technology (OT), communication technology, and information technology (IT) enterprise systems.

The smart factory is one of the main components of Manufacturing 4.0 enterprises invest in; during their Manufacturing 4.0 journey.

Smart Factory

A smart factory is created by the acquisition of smart assets, retrofitting of non-smart equipment, and/or feeding of data from PLCs or local storage to an IoT gateway.

Real-time control, monitoring, notifications, alerts, and event management from multiple devices anywhere in the world; lead to a digitized and collaborating shop floor and are the characteristics of a smart factory.

Thus, smart factories allow companies to improve complex operational and manufacturing processes and to drive business growth from better data-driven insights.

Most importantly, as the cost of retrofitting equipment and sensors decline; more small, medium, and large companies are expected to invest in smart factories.
